Transaction 8e52a4deae164b4e8623eba533458748aaa345daee937514c77c9b22e2e704ad
1 Input
2 Outputs
- 8e52a4deae164b4e8623eba533458748aaa345daee937514c77c9b22e2e704ad:0
- 8e52a4deae164b4e8623eba533458748aaa345daee937514c77c9b22e2e704ad:1
value 47667691
address 19Y89cPhu1xRwpEF1Yu6StVB2ZeRM9hroK
value 3625984
address 3FXyJZNed6Xme4kaqEKPnTW8Gbx3JMbmj9